What is a Ford Key Fob?
A Ford key fob is a little electronic device that allows a chauffeur to manage different functions of their car, such as unlocking and locking the doors, starting the engine, and triggering the alarm without the need for a standard metal key. Numerous more recent Ford designs also provide functions such as remote start, trunk release, and access to other convenience functions that boost the user experience.
How Does a Key Fob Work?
A key fob runs by means of radio frequency (RF) signals. When a button on the key fob is pushed, it sends out a distinct code to the vehicle's onboard computer, which recognizes the signal and carries out the asked for action. This innovation not only supplies benefit however also adds a layer of security by requiring the right key fob to access the vehicle.

Requirement Key Fob
This is the most typical type and includes basic performances like locking and opening the lorry.
2. Smart Key Fob
Called keyless entry fobs, these gadgets allow the driver to open the doors by just approaching the car with the fob in their pocket or bag. They frequently include a push-start ignition system.
3. Remote Start Key Fob
This type provides the included advantage of beginning the car remotely, perfect for warming it up during winter.
4. Integrated Key Fob
Integrating traditional keys and functions of a fob, this type is more versatile and serves as a backup in case of electronic failure.

Change the Battery: Most key fobs use an easy 3V battery that can be easily changed. If the buttons are unresponsive, consider altering the battery first.

Reprogram the Key Fob: After replacing the battery, some key fobs may require to be reprogrammed. Examine the owner's handbook for specific directions.

Contact Customer Support: If problems continue, connecting to Ford client assistance or going to a dealer may be necessary.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How do I know if my Ford key fob battery is dying?
Signs of a dying key fob battery include decreased variety, requiring several efforts to lock/unlock and non-responsiveness to button presses.
2. Can I configure a new key fob myself?
Many Ford models permit owners to program additional key fobs. However, this procedure may differ, and it is advisable to seek advice from the owner's manual or get in touch with a dealer for particular guidelines.
3. What should I do if I lose my Ford key fob?
If you lose your key fob, it's essential to contact your local Ford dealer. They can offer a replacement and program it to your lorry.
4. Are Ford key fobs water resistant?
While most key fobs are developed to stand up to direct exposure to moisture, they are not necessarily waterproof. It's best to prevent immersing them in water.
5. The length of time does a key fob battery last?
Typically, a key fob battery can last anywhere from three to 5 years, depending upon use frequency and the particular design.
